1. What is Bandwidth?

Bandwidth refers to the maximum rate of data transfer across a given path. It's typically measured in bits per second (bps) and is a key metric in network performance and capacity planning.

5. Frequently Asked Questions (FAQ)

Q1: What's the difference between bandwidth and speed?
A: Bandwidth refers to capacity (maximum possible transfer rate), while speed refers to actual transfer rate which can be affected by various factors.

Q2: How do I convert bits to bytes?
A: Divide bits by 8 to get bytes (1 byte = 8 bits). For bandwidth, 1 Mbps = 0.125 MBps.

Q3: What are typical bandwidth requirements?
A: It varies: Email needs ~0.1 Mbps, HD video ~5 Mbps, 4K video ~25 Mbps, etc.

Q4: How does latency affect bandwidth?
A: High latency doesn't reduce bandwidth but can make the connection feel slower due to delays in data transmission.

Q5: What's the difference between Mbps and MBps?
A: Mbps is megabits per second, MBps is megabytes per second. 8 Mbps = 1 MBps.
